Costas Papaconstantinou is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Ecology and Aquatic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Costas Papaconstantinou has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 34 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 17 papers in Ecology and 17 papers in Aquatic Science. Recurrent topics in Costas Papaconstantinou’s work include Marine and fisheries research (30 papers), Fish Biology and Ecology Studies (16 papers) and Marine Bivalve and Aquaculture Studies (12 papers). Costas Papaconstantinou is often cited by papers focused on Marine and fisheries research (30 papers), Fish Biology and Ecology Studies (16 papers) and Marine Bivalve and Aquaculture Studies (12 papers). Costas Papaconstantinou collaborates with scholars based in Greece, Italy and Maldives. Costas Papaconstantinou's co-authors include A. Souplet, Luís Gil de Sola, Jacques Bertrand, Giulio Rélini, H. Farrugio, Christos D. Maravelias, Vassiliki Vassilopoulou, Μ. Labropoulou, Efthymia V. Tsitsika and Dimitrios Damalas and has published in prestigious journals such as Marine Ecology Progress Series, Hydrobiologia and Estuarine Coastal and Shelf Science.
